.mpl-section{max-width:var(--page-width, 120rem);margin:0 auto;padding-left:3rem;padding-right:3rem}@media screen and (max-width:749px){.mpl-section{padding-left:2rem;padding-right:2rem}}.mpl__header{margin-bottom:5.6rem}.mpl__label{display:block;font-size:1.1rem;letter-spacing:.22em;text-transform:uppercase;opacity:.45;margin-bottom:1.4rem}.mpl__heading{font-size:clamp(2.2rem,3vw,3.2rem);font-weight:300;line-height:1.25;letter-spacing:.01em;margin:0}.mpl__grid{display:grid;grid-template-columns:repeat(2,1fr);gap:4rem}@media screen and (max-width:749px){.mpl__grid{grid-template-columns:1fr;gap:5.6rem}}.mpl__entry{display:flex;flex-direction:column}.mpl__image-link{display:block;overflow:hidden;margin-bottom:2.8rem}.mpl__image-wrapper{position:relative;overflow:hidden;aspect-ratio:4 / 3}.mpl__image{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;display:block;transition:transform .55s ease}.mpl__entry:hover .mpl__image{transform:scale(1.025)}.mpl__entry-body{flex:1;display:flex;flex-direction:column}.mpl__eyebrow{display:block;font-size:1.1rem;letter-spacing:.22em;text-transform:uppercase;opacity:.45;margin-bottom:1.2rem}.mpl__title{font-size:clamp(2rem,2.5vw,2.6rem);font-weight:300;line-height:1.2;letter-spacing:.01em;margin:0 0 1.6rem}.mpl__title-link{color:inherit;text-decoration:none}.mpl__title-link:hover{opacity:.7}.mpl__description{font-size:1.4rem;line-height:1.9;opacity:.68;margin:0 0 2.4rem;max-width:42rem}.mpl__link{display:inline-flex;align-items:center;gap:.6rem;font-size:1.3rem;letter-spacing:.06em;text-decoration:none;color:inherit;opacity:.7;margin-top:auto;transition:opacity .2s ease,gap .2s ease;border-bottom:1px solid currentColor;padding-bottom:.2rem}.mpl__link:hover{opacity:1;gap:1rem}.mpl__link-arrow{transition:transform .2s ease}.mpl__link:hover .mpl__link-arrow{transform:translate(3px)}
/*# sourceMappingURL=/cdn/shop/t/37/assets/madoka-product-lines.css.map */
